Dragon’s Weakness

 

I am carnage incarnate. I am the end bringer. These pests have encroached on our sacred land for long enough. Three thousand years ago they showed up. They seemed harmless enough. Ones that have perished long ago even brought some tasty offerings, worshiping us like gods. We quickly realized the pests only live long enough to blink your eyes. Very quickly forgot about our offerings, growing to fear us. One thousand years ago they found how to utilize the magic that has always been flowing through the land. That’s when they became more than pests they started stinging. 

Occasionally unwilling sacrifices that thought they could somehow slay us and escape their fate would venture to us. We found this amusing at first. We still gave pests no thought until they took our elder from us. She had lived a long life spanning twenty thousand years. We honored her and often sought her wisdom. She was kind and loved by all. She was getting frail in her old age. She had already outlived the average lifespan by five thousand years. 

The pests finally found our weakness, but not in the way they thought. Instead of taking out one weak dragon and having one less to worry about. They have awoken the nests. We swarmed the hovels they called home till only ash was left.
